A Professional Certificate in Epidemiology of Radon Gas is increasingly significant in today's UK market. Radon, a naturally occurring radioactive gas, poses a serious health risk, contributing to a substantial number of lung cancer deaths annually. According to Public Health England, radon is estimated to cause around 1,100 lung cancer deaths in the UK each year. This underscores the growing need for skilled professionals to address radon-related issues, from risk assessment to mitigation strategies.
